Solar Flash/Force

Choking Clothing, textiles and fashion items Serious risk

Solar Flash/Force was recalled on 25 September 2015 under EU Safety Gate alert A12/1146/15. Choking risk reported by United Kingdom. The soft plastic panels which cover lights on the outside upper part of the sandal can tear and detach, causing a potential choking risk to small children.

Risk Description

The soft plastic panels which cover lights on the outside upper part of the sandal can tear and detach, causing a potential choking risk to small children.

Measures Taken

Type of economic operator taking notified measure(s): OtherCategory of measure(s): Recall of the product from end usersDate of entry into force: 20/08/2015

Product Description

Children's trainer type sandals in separate colours of blue, red or green. Various shoe sizes.
